SLOW COOKER BABY BACK RIBS

These are the best I've had, short of the actual grilling method of course! This is a very simple recipe that I came up with a few years ago. It's not rocket science, just ribs cooked in the slow cooker and finished in the oven. This is what I do when I want ribs during the week and have to work all day. I'm eating them within a half-hour of getting home, and they turn out perfect every time!

Steps:

  • Season ribs with salt and pepper.
  • Pour water into slow cooker. Layer the ribs into the slow cooker. Top the ribs with onion and garlic.
  • Cook on High for 4 hours (or Low for 8 hours).
  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• Transfer ribs to a baking sheet. Discard onion and garlic. Coat ribs with barbeque sauce.
  • Bake in preheated oven until the sauce caramelizes and sticks to the meat, 10 to 15 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 501.2 calories, Carbohydrate 32.4 g, Cholesterol 117 mg, Fat 29.6 g, Fiber 0.8 g, Protein 24.3 g, SaturatedFat 10.9 g, Sodium 1067.4 mg, Sugar 22.7 g

3 pounds baby back ribs, trimmed
salt and ground black pepper, to taste
½ cup water
½ onion, sliced
1 clove garlic, minced
1 (18 ounce) bottle barbeque sauce

MOMS OPEN PIT CROCKPOT RIBS

My mom makes the best crock pot ribs ever! I think the secret is using open pit BBQ sauce.. She's tried it with other sauces but it just isn't the same! Serve with corn on the cob and rice! yum!!

Steps:

  • 1. Season the ribs with garlic and onion salt and fresh cracked pepper.
  • 2. Broil ribs, turning once, until just browned on both sides.
  • 3. Place sliced onions in a layer on the bottom of the crock pot. Add broiled ribs and BBQ sauce. Cover and cook on low 10 hours.

15 country style ribs
1 large white onion (peeled and sliced into thin rings)
4 bottles of open pit bbq sauce
garlic and onion salt and freshly cracked pepper (to taste)

MOMO'S FAMOUS CROCK POT RIBS

Steps:

  • In a bowl mix all of the ingredients except the water and ribs.
  • Reserve 1 cup of the sauce and refrigerate.
  • Mix in the water to the rest of the sauce.
  • Place ribs in crock pot and cover with sauce.
  • Cook on low for 8-10 hours.
  • When done cooking preheat oven on broil.
  • Place ribs on foil lined cooking sheet.
  • Baste with the reserve sauce and put in the oven for 10-15 minutes until just a bit crispy. Make sure you have a lot of paper towels. Enjoy.

1 1/2 cups marmalade
1/2 cup ketchup
3 tablespoons soya sauce
3/4 cup barbecue sauce (preferably Bull's Eye bold or hickory)
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on chili powder
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1 cup water
3 lbs ribs

MOM'S EASY CROCK POT BBQ RIBS

This is how my mom always made BBQ ribs, and it can't get any easier. This method keeps the sauce nice & thick. I'm posting it here mainly to see what the nutritional information is.

Steps:

  • Place ribs in crock pot and season with salt and pepper to taste. Cook on low all day-- 6-8 hours.
  • About an hour before supper time, drain all the liquid from the pot. Return ribs to pot and pour in the BBQ sauce. Simmer on low another hour.
  • Serve and en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 652.1, Fat 45, SaturatedFat 15.1, Cholesterol 156.5, Sodium 1277.6, Carbohydrate 18, Fiber 1.7, Sugar 5.5, Protein 41.1

2 lbs boneless pork ribs
1 (18 ounce) bottle favorite barbecue sauce (we like thick & spicy KC Masterpiece)
salt & pepper, to taste

MOM'S BEST RIBS

My mom shared this recipe with me several years ago. Family and friends agree these are the best ribs they've ever tasted!

Steps:

  • Cut ribs into serving-size pieces. Place ribs, meat side up, in a roasting pan. Bake, uncovered, at 325° for 2 hours; drain. Combine remaining ingredients; pour over ribs. Bake, uncovered, for 1 to 1-1/4 hours longer or until ribs are tender, basting occasionally.

Nutrition Facts :

4 pounds pork baby back ribs
3/4 cup chicken broth
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up spicy brown mustard
1/4 cup Dijon mustard
3 tablespoons steak sauce
3 tablespoons soy sauce
3/4 teaspoon hot pepper sauce
1/4 teaspoon ground cloves

  • In a small bowl, stir together brown sugar, chili powder, salt, cumin, paprika, garlic powder, and onion powder. Set aside.
  • Prepare the ribs by removing the shiny, thin membrane that covers most of the backside of the ribs. To do so, use a knife or fingernail to pry up a corner of the thin membrane from one edge of the ribs. Grab that with a paper towel (for grip) and slowly pull it up. Once a good portion of the membrane is free, you should be able to pull the rest off in one quick motion.
  • Pat the ribs dry and rub the seasoning mixture onto both sides of the ribs. Place ribs in slow cooker.
